Actor Gary Sinise Leaves Hollywood After Son's Cancer Death
Gary Sinise, best known for his role as Lieutenant Dan in Forrest Gump, has stepped away from acting to prioritize family following the death of his son, Mac Sinise, who passed away in January 2024 after a 5½-year battle with the rare spinal cancer chordoma. Sinise left Hollywood in 2019 to care for Mac full-time and has since focused on sharing his late son's music and cherishing time with his wife, daughters, and five grandchildren. His wife Moira also survived stage 3 breast cancer, a challenge the family faced alongside Mac's illness. Sinise has expressed uncertainty about returning to acting, emphasizing that it is harder to leave home now and that family is his central focus. He has found comfort in his Tennessee home and is committed to preserving Mac's legacy through his music. Despite rumors of involvement in an upcoming film related to veterans, Sinise's statements indicate he is unlikely to resume his acting career soon.
